An Oregon resident was diagnosed with the plague. Here are a few things to know about the illness

Officials in central Oregon this week reported a case of bubonic plague in a resident who likely got the disease from a sick pet cat. The infected resident, the cat, and the resident’s close contacts have all been provided medication, public health officials say, and people in the community are not believed to be at risk.
